We are looking for a skilled HL TA to join our hard-working, committed team of professionals. Your role will be supporting children with in class learning and interventions across the school from EYFS to KS2. As HLTA, you will be covering PPA and management times in different year groups which will involve whole class teaching responsibility. St James CE Primary School is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ment. All appointments are subject to satisfactory references and clearances, including an enhanced disclosure from the Disclosure and Barring Service/ and or barred list checks.

This post is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 and is eligible for an enhanced DBS check including a Children’s Barring List Check. If you are barred from working with children you are breaking the law if you apply for this post

This post is covered by Part 7 of the Immigration Act (2016) and therefore the ability to speak fluent and spoken English is an essential requirement for this role

Hours:32.5hrs per week - Term Time plus 5 INSET days

Grade:Grade E, SCP 18-25 (£30,559 - £35,235 p.a.) Actual Salary - £23,952 - £28,569 p.a.
